# SOLAR PANEL INSTALLATION AGREEMENT

Date: 3 February 2030

Parties: Sunward Energy Solutions Limited and Priya Desai

## 1. Parties and purpose

Sunward Energy Solutions Limited (Company No. 12840119), 15 Enterprise Park, Reading RG2 0AA (Installer), agrees with Priya Desai of 26 Orchard Rise, Reading RG1 6HT (Homeowner) to supply and install a 4.8 kWp rooftop solar PV system and 5.2 kWh battery at 26 Orchard Rise.

## 2. Scope, price and subject

The fixed price is £12,960 including VAT, payable £500 on acceptance, £6,230 after survey and £6,230 on commissioning. The specification states 12 panels, inverter, battery, scaffolding, cabling, monitoring app, removal of packaging and DNO notification. Any roof strengthening or asbestos work requires a separate quote and Priya's approval.

## 3. Operating duties

Sunward will survey the roof, explain forecast generation without guaranteeing savings, arrange competent installation and seek Distribution Network Operator approval where required. It will provide MCS documentation, electrical certificates, commissioning data and export-tariff information; Priya must give access, disclose roof defects and obtain mortgagee or planning consent if needed.

## 4. Rights, records and compliance

Sunward warrants workmanship for five years, panels for 25 years' performance under the manufacturer's terms, inverter for ten years and battery for ten years or its stated cycle limit. It will correct defects within a reasonable time and provide after-care contact details. Priya must not alter the system or use an unapproved installer during warranty work.

## 5. Term, ending and remedies

The installer follows Building Regulations, electrical safety requirements, MCS standards, consumer-protection law and waste rules. It carries £2 million public-liability insurance and protects Priya's personal data under UK GDPR. Equipment remains Sunward's property until paid in full, but risk passes on safe delivery and title then transfers.

## 6. Liability and reservations

Priya has any applicable Consumer Contracts Regulations cancellation right; if she requests installation during that period, she pays only the proportion properly performed before cancellation. Either party may terminate for uncured material breach. Sunward must make good reasonable installation damage, and Priya pays for approved extra work.

## 7. Governing law and signatures

England and Wales law governs and its courts have jurisdiction. Priya and Sunward's director Alex Moore sign on 3 February 2030 after receiving the specification, total price, cancellation information, MCS status and complaints route. No forecast is a guaranteed energy saving or grid-export income.
